Chester County, Pennsylvania Records<\/h1>\n\n\n\n

Chester County, Pennsylvania<\/strong> (Map It<\/a>)<\/em> was created on November 1682<\/strong> as one of the three original counties. The county was named for the English city of\u00a0Chester<\/a>\u00a0in the county of\u00a0Cheshire<\/a>. <\/p>\n\n

Chester County<\/strong> is bordered by Berks County<\/a> (north), Montgomery County<\/a> (northeast), Delaware County<\/a> (east), New Castle County, Delaware<\/a> (southeast), Cecil County, Maryland<\/a> (south), Lancaster County<\/a> (west). Chester County<\/strong> Townships include \u00a0Birmingham, Caln, Charlestown, East Bradford, East Brandywine, East Caln, East Coventry, East Fallowfield, East Goshen, East Marlborough, East Nantmeal, East Nottingham, East Pikeland, East Vincent, East Whiteland, Easttown, Elk, Franklin, Highland, Honey Brook, Kennett, London Britain, London Grove, Londonderry, Lower Oxford, New Garden, New London, Newlin, North Coventry, Penn, Pennsbury, Pocopson, Sadsbury, Schuylkill, South Coventry, Thornbury, Tredyffrin, Upper Oxford, Upper Uwchlan, Uwchlan, Valley, Wallace, Warwick, West Bradford, West Brandywine, West Caln, West Fallowfield, West Goshen, West Marlborough, West Nantmeal, West Nottingham, West Pikeland, West Sadsbury, West Vincent, West Whiteland, Westtown, Willistown. <\/p>\n\n

Chester County<\/strong> Boroughs include \u00a0Atglevondale, Downingtown, Elverson, Honey Brook, Kennett Square, Malvern, Modena, Oxford, Parkesburg, Phoenixville, South Coatesville, Spring City, West Chester, West Grove. <\/p>\n\n

Chester County<\/strong> Cities & Towns include\u00a0Coatesville. See also Chester County Municipalities Incorporation Dates<\/a>.<\/p>\n\n
